Finland's medieval mother church and present national Pilgrimage Center, where St. Henry's relics were translated in 1300 before their later disappearance.

What makes this visit meaningful
Turku is the gateway to St. Henry's Way and to Finland's renewed pilgrimage culture. The cathedral preserves the altars, spaces, and documentary memory of Henry's cult, but the medieval reliquary and most relics did not survive as a visitable shrine.
